Abstract: The effect of physical training on glucose tolerance in vivo and skeletal muscle glucose metabolism in vitro was investigated in normal rats. Treadmill running for 10 days up to 240 min/day led to a decrease of basal and glucose-stimulated plasma insulin levels without major alterations of the IV glucose tolerance (1 g/kg body weight). Swim training of two weeks' duration, i. e. exercise up to 2×75 min/ day, which did not induce significant changes in body composition, skeletal muscle glycogen levels or citrate synthase activity, resulted in a significant improvement of IV glucose tolerance and substantial reductions of basal and glucose-stimulated plasma insulin levels. Associated with this apparent improvement of insulin sensitivity in vivo, significant increases of the insulin-stimulated glucose uptake (+ 55%) and lactate oxidation (+ 78%) in vitro were found on perfusion of the isolated hindquarter of swim-trained animals. It is suggested that mild physical training can improve glucose tolerance and insulin sensitivity in normal rats, at least in part, due to an increase of insulin sensitivity of skeletal muscle glucose metabolism.

Abstract: The effects of post-trial injection of substance P (SP) into the lateral hypothalamus (LH) and the ventromedial hypothalamus (VMH) on passive avoidance learning was studied in rats. In the VMH, 50 ng and 500 ng SP influenced neither learning of a step-down avoidance nor of an alcove avoidance response. In contrast to these findings, 500 ng SP injected into the LH significantly enhanced retention of the alcove avoidance task. Similarly, in the step-down avoidance experiment, learning was strongly facilitated by posttrial injection of 50 ng as well as 500 ng SP into the LH. These results, together with our previous data showing amnesia with posttrial injection of SP into amygdala and substantia nigra, suggest that exogenously applied SP influences the activity of those brain regions shown to contain high densities of SP-positive nerve terminals. Interestingly, the effects of posttrial SP injection parallel the effects of post-trial electrical brain stimulation on passive avoidance learning. Hence, posttrial SP retroactively facilitates or impairs depending on where in the brain it is injected.

Abstract: On helically cut strips of the rabbit's mesenteric artery, a temperature decrease from 42°C to 25°C reduced the contractile responses to histamine. Metiamide shifted the dose-response curve of the histamine-induced contraction towards higher values at 25°C, but not at 42°C. Furthermore, on arterial strips contracted by phenylephrine histamine evoked a dose-dependent relaxation at 25°C whereas at 42°C only slight relaxing responses to histamine occurred. Metiamide was capable of preventing the relaxation induced by histamine in a competitive manner. At 25°C the relaxation as produced by histamine was accompanied by increases in cyclic AMP which occurred prior to the relaxing effects. Metiamide abolished the cyclic AMP increase in response to histamine. At 42°C histamine was unable to elevate the cyclic AMP content. Thus, it is concluded that a cyclic AMP-mediated relexation due to stimulation of H2-receptors counteracts the histamine-induced contraction and reduces the contractile responses to histamine at low temperatures. In addition, clear-cut evidence exists from the present study that also on artery smooth muscle the H2-receptor-mediated responses are closely associated to cyclic AMP.

Abstract: Because of the higher risk of cancer in the gastric stump, an increased incidence of pre-cancerous conditions should be exspected also in the resected stomach. Therefore, a combined endoscopic and bioptic study was performed in order to investigate the incidence of dysplasias in the gastric stump after resection for benign conditions. Among 101 patients with gastric resection, 2 cases were excluded from this study because of preceeding gastric cancer and one because of cancer of the gastric stump. In 43 of the remaining 98 patients, a Billroth-I-resection (gastroduodenostomy) had been carried out. In the remaining 55 patients with a Billroth-II-resection (gastroenterostomy) 9 had an additional enteroanastomosis of Braun whereas in the residual 46 patients this enteroanastomosis was lacking. This distinction was made because of a facultative or obligatory bile reflux. The average age of the B-I-group was 68 years, of the B-II-group with enteroanastomosis 69 years, and the B-II-group without enteroanastomosis 62 years. A non-operated group matched for age served as control group. Biopsy particles from the anastomotic region were gained by endoscopy and cut in step sections. The classification of dysplasias (degree I-III) followed the criteria given by Nagayo as modified by Grundmann. Inflammatory reactive changes were separated from these. A few changes could not be classified definitely and were listed as unclassified dysplasia. While dysplastic changes of low degree were quite numerous in every group, the dysplasias of higher degree were only found in a small number of cases. In the 46 cases with B-II-resection without Braun's enteroanastomosis, there were 5 dysplasia II and 3 dysplasia II. In the 9 cases with B-II-resection and with Braun's enteroanastomosis, there was 1 dysplasia I and no dysplasia III. In the 43 patient with B-I-resection only 2 dysplasia II and no dysplasia III were found. In the control group of 98 patients matched for age there were only 5 cases with dysplasia I and 1 case with dysplasia III. Patients with higher degrees of dysplasia showed a higher age and a longer interval after operation. There was also a correlation between higher degrees of dysplasia and severe atrophic changes in the mucosa. Correlating the degree of dysplasia with the reason for gastric resection, most of the dysplastic changes occurred in patients resected for gastric ulcer, whereas cases resected for duodenal ulcer showed only 2 dysplasias I. The discussion refers to the few data about dysplasia of the gastric stump available from the literature. Atrophic and increased regenerative changes obviously play a role in the pathogenesis of these dysplastic changes. As a causative factor the role of bile reflux is discussed. A further diagnostic and therapeutic regimen for the different forms of dysplasia is proposed.

Abstract: A patient with a progressive neurological disorder beginning at the age of three years is described. Mental and visual disturbances were the first signs, soon followed by ataxia and myoclonic jerks. Fundoscopy revealed a decreased pigmentation of the retina. Ultramicroscopic investigations of muscle and skin disclosed the typical changes seen in the late infantile and juvenile forms of neuronal ceroid-lipofuscinosis. In contrast to the clinical and ultrastructural findings, the fatty acid pattern of the serum lecithin showed a significant increase of arachidonic acid and a corresponding decrease of linoleic acid which is characteristic of the so-called infantile form of neuronal ceroid-lipofuscinosis (Hagberg-Santavuori variant; polyunsaturated fatty acid lipidosis). The obvious heterogeneity of the clinical, histological and laboratory findings within the subgroups of neuronal ceroid-lipofuscinosis is briefly discussed.

Abstract: The diagnostic significance of orcein, aldehydthionine, and chromotrope anilinblue stains for the demonstration of HBsAg containing hepatocytes was investigated in 602 unselected liver biopsies. Five types of specifically stained ground-glass hepatocytes (GGH) were distinguished: Type I showed a positive staining reaction of the cytoplasmic periphery (marginal GGH), type II a diffuse staining of the total cytoplasm (diffuse GGH). Type III contained round or oval globular positive cytoplasmic masses (globular GGH). Type IV showed only very small round, drop-like or sickle-shaped positive structures (spotty GGH). The GGH with fatty changes were designated as type V. In all carriers and patients with minimal hepatitis GGH, mostly type I and II, appeared in extensive clusters within the lobules. In chronic persistent hepatitis, there were moderately numerous, partly grouped, partly disseminated ground-glass hepatocytes of type II and III. In chronic active hepatitis there were only a few GGH of type IV. In acute viral hepatitis, there were no typical GGH, however, positively stained phagocytes were seen. The intracellular antigen localization and the intralobular distribution of GGH are considered to be the result of an immune reaction. Single so-called 'metabolic' GGH sometimes showed similar pictures. However, they could usually be distinguished from virus containing GGH because of their granular cytoplasmic structure and a lower staining intensity in the applied stains. Among the three stains the orcein stain yielded the best results. In some cases with HBsAg-positive chronic active hepatitis virus infection could not be proved by means of staining.

Abstract: This is a report of clinical, morphological, diagnostic, endocrinological and therapeutical experiences with 18 patients with tumours in the pineal region. The histological diagnosis was verified in four cases by autopsy, in seven cases by biopsy, and in one case by microscopical verification of tumour cells in the CSF. In all biopsy cases we are dealing with typical germinomas. In the other clinical cases diagnosis was made by neuroradiological and endocrinological methods. The localization was possible by encephalotomography or CT scan, according to Kageyama. Particular attention was given to the endocrinological dysfunctions which originate in the hypothalamus. Also the hypothalamic dysfunctions after irradiation were discussed. Since the results of primary surgical approach and biopsy have been unsatisfactory, we preferred a non-operative schedule for treatment of pineal tumours.

Abstract: pH-Control of the Carbon Cycle . On illumination, chloroplasts pump protons from the stroma not only into the thylakoid compartment, but also across the chloroplast envelope into the extra-chloroplast space. Increased proton back leakage from a neutral medium into the stroma as mediated by some salts of weak acids inhibited photosynthesis, and inhibition was strongly pH-de-pendent. It was caused by acidification of the stroma which inactivated fructose and sedoheptulose bisphosphatases. The stroma pH controlled not only activity, but also light-activation of fructose bisphosphatase, thus amplifying pH-control of photosynthesis. Light-activation of glyceraldehydephosphate dehydrogenase (NADP) and of malic dehydrogenase (NADP) was also sensitive to pH, while activation of phosphoribulokinase did not respond to salts that caused stroma acidification only. However, with potassium nitrite which decreases the stroma pH and also oxidizes ferredoxin activation became pH-dependent. Fructose bisphosphatase, phosphoribulokinase and malic dehydrogenase remained in the activated state when the stroma pH was decreased in the light, while light-activation of glyceraldehydephosphate dehydrogenase was reversed at a decreased stroma pH.

Abstract: The spin density and zero-field splitting (ZFS) of the lowest triplet state of a light metal porphin are determined by means of a Pariser-Parr-Pople ground state SCF π-electron MO-calculation with CI. Only the pz -orbitals of the carbon and nitrogen atoms are considered. The semi-empirical values of the integrals involving nitrogen orbitals are varied between the values commonly used for pyrrole and pyridine-type nitrogen. The two lower triplet states (corresponding to the excitations 3(eg ←a 2u ) and 3(eg ←a 1 u ) in Gouterman's four orbital model) are considered, both for a b 1g and a b 2g the spin densities determined by McLachlan's extended Hartree-Fock method lead to a perfect explanation of the hyperfine structure observed for zinc porphin and magnesium porphin in n-octane. Abstract: The human population is exposed to a wide variety of insecticides, drugs, fungicides, and other environmental chemicals. Most of these xenobiotics are metabolized by membrane-bound, mixed function oxidases, which require NADPH/NADH and molecular oxygen. This oxidative metabolic step is mostly a hydroxylation, catalyzed by enzyme systems involving the CO-sensitive terminal monooxygenase cytochrome P-450. Cytochrome P-450 is a multicomponent group of mixed function oxidases which shows its highest activity in the endoplasmatic reticulum of the liver; however other tissues such as kidneys, small intestine, lungs, brain, lymphocytes and skin also contain these enzymes (Ullrich and Kremers, 1977). Cutaneous cytochrome P-450 may be of considerable interest in the biotransformation of potentially toxic chemicals of the environment. On the other hand, the oxidative metabolism of various drugs by the skin cytochrome P-450 may lead to the formation of reactive metabolites which are often carcinogens, mutagens or cytotoxic agents. In view of the biological importance of the skin cytochrome P-450, we found it of interest to determine it's concentration and inducibility in rat skin microsomes during a long-time exposition to hexachlorobenzene (HCB). This chlorinated aromatic hydrocarbon is a world-wide distributed fungicide which has proved to be a potent inducer of the cytochrome P-450 in the liver of experimental animals (Stonard, 1975; Doss et al., 1976). Abstract: On guinea-pig ileum and rabbit mesenteric artery contracted by high potassium (100 mM) histamine produced relaxations which were inhibited by the H2-receptor antagonist metiamide. These results are thus indicative for the role of H2-receptors in mediating relaxation and for H1-receptors in mediating contraction on smooth muscle. Time course studies for the relaxing and cyclic AMP responses to histamine showed that the cyclic AMP increase preceded the H2-receptor mediated relaxation. The cyclic AMP increase in response to histamine was prevented by metiamide, but remained unaffected by mepyramine on both the guinea-pig ileum and the rabbit mesenteric artery. In addition, dose-response curves obtained on the mesenteric artery demonstrated that the H2-receptor mediated depressor responses coincided with cyclic AMP increases. Thus, these results gave clear-cut evidence that cyclic AMP is an intracellular metabolic event only implicit in the H2-receptor mediated relaxation, but not in the H1-receptor mediated contraction on smooth muscle preparations.

Abstract: We consider the 4×4 scattering matrixS for a plane wave incident on a plane-stratified gyrotropic multilayer slab, which is assumed to have a single symmetry axis (the magnetisation vector in a ferrite sheet, or the external magnetic field direction in a plane-stratified magnetoplasma). In the given (original) problem the plane of incidence is at an azimuthal angle ϕ with respect to the magnetic meridian plane (the plane containing the normal to the stratification, and the gyrotropic symmetry axis), and there is a corresponding “conjugate” set of wave fields, in which the plane of incidence is at an azimuthal angle (π−ϕ), with a corresponding conjugate scattering matrixS′. Adjoint wave fields, obtained by reversing the magnetic symmetry vector, are used to yield the eigenmode amplitudes required in the definition of the scattering matrices. At an interface between two adjacent layers the scattering matrices are shown to be uniquely determined by the characteristic wave polarisations, and this is used to prove that the given and conjugate scattering matrices,S andS′, for the overall multilayer system are mutually transposed, i.e.\(S = \tilde S'\).

Abstract: A general scheme is given to determine the matrix representation of the differential operator of the kinetic theory of gas mixtures, i.e., the streaming operator in the one‐particle phase space. The matrix elements are evaluated explicitly for the Burnett basis functions and a Lorentz type external field. The density, temperature, and mean velocity are treated as field quantities in order to assure the applicability of the results to inhomogeneous problems.

Abstract: The caffeine derivative 8-ethoxycaffeine (EOC) was tested in 3 different test systems in vitro. Each experiment was carried out with and without S9 mix. Incubation temperatures were 20 and 37dgC. 1. (1) In the Salmonella/microsome test, EOC behaved as a pro-mutagen in the Salmonella typhimurium strain TA1535. No mutagenic activity was found in experiments without S9 mix. The influence of temperature was negligible. The mutagenic activity of EOC depended mainly on the mammals used to prepare the S9 fraction and on the agents given to them to induce liver enzymes. 2. (2) EOC did not induce sister-chromatid exchanges in cell cultures, either at 20 or at 37°C. 3. (3) On the other hand, EOC induced chromosomal aberrations when the cells were incubated at 37°C without S9 mix.
